Variants of Samsung Galaxy J3

The Samsung Galaxy J3 comes in several variants, each tailored to suit different markets and user needs. Variants include the Galaxy J3 (2016), J3 (2017), and J3 Pro, among others, each featuring slight differences in specifications and design. The various models typically feature the following notable distinctions:

  • Galaxy J3 (2016)
    -Launched with 1.5 GB of RAM and an internal storage option of 8 GB, expandable via microSD. It operates on Android Marshmallow.
  • Galaxy J3 (2017)
    -An upgrade with 2 GB of RAM and 16 GB of internal storage, it supports higher performance with Android Nougat. This variant introduced a more refined design with enhanced build quality.
  • Galaxy J3 Pro
    -Aimed at users seeking a bit more power, this variant included 3 GB of RAM and 16 GB of internal storage, providing improved multitasking capabilities and overall performance.

The Galaxy J3 series has been made available in different regions, including North America, Europe, and Asia, with specific configurations tailored to the user preferences and network compatibility in those markets. The device’s versatility in variant options ensures that it remains an appealing choice for a wide range of users seeking affordable technology solutions.

Maximizing Camera Capabilities

To truly harness the camera’s capabilities, understanding and optimizing settings is crucial. Here are some tips for getting the best results from the Samsung Galaxy J3’s camera:

  • Utilize HDR Mode: This feature is essential for capturing high-contrast scenes, as it balances the exposure between the light and dark areas, producing a more vibrant image.
  • Night Mode: When shooting in low-light conditions, activate the night mode to enhance brightness and reduce noise, ensuring clearer images.
  • Experiment with Focus: Use the tap-to-focus feature to ensure the subject is sharp, especially in portrait shots where clarity is paramount.
  • Stabilization Techniques: To avoid blurriness, keep your hands steady or use a tripod for longer exposures, particularly in dim environments.
  • Use the Grid Lines: Enabling the grid lines helps in following the rule of thirds, improving composition and balance in your photos.

Recommended Apps for Enhanced Functionality

Given the Galaxy J3’s hardware limitations, selecting the right applications can greatly enhance its usability without overwhelming its system resources. The following list highlights recommended apps that can complement the Samsung Galaxy J3’s capabilities effectively:

  • Google Go: This lightweight search app saves space and improves browsing speed, making it ideal for users needing quick access to information without heavy resource consumption.
  • Facebook Lite: A stripped-down version of the regular Facebook app, it offers essential features while using significantly less data and storage.
  • Spotify Lite: For music lovers, Spotify Lite provides essential streaming functionality with a smaller footprint, ensuring smoother playback on the J3.
  • Microsoft Office Lens: This app enables users to scan documents and convert them into PDFs or editable Word files, enhancing productivity without requiring high processing power.
  • Opera Mini: A fast and data-efficient browser, Opera Mini compresses web pages for faster loading times, making browsing on the J3 more enjoyable.
  • Google Maps Go: A lightweight version of Google Maps, this app provides essential navigation features while minimizing the device’s resource usage.
